accomplish (your goals), flourish, fulfil (your potential), occupy (your time), (overcome) a setback, (present) a challenge, (pursue) your interest, (be) a pain, (do something) from scratch, go hand in hand, keep your cool, (pass) with flying colours, (have) the best of both worlds, (beat off) competitors, come up against (a problem), come through (a difficult time), come up with (an idea), hold back, live up to (expectations), pull out (of something).




